How they compare
Bolivia, Plurinational State of currently reports 77.4% against 72.7% in Rwanda, a difference of 4.7%.
That makes Bolivia, Plurinational State of's figure about 1.1 times Rwanda's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 13 shared years of data; in 1989 it was Rwanda ahead.
Bolivia, Plurinational State of ranks 12th and Rwanda ranks 15th of 178 countries.
Across the 5 decades both report, Bolivia, Plurinational State of averaged higher in 2 and Rwanda in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bolivia, Plurinational State of | Rwanda |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 48.4% | 88.0% | 39.6% | Rwanda |
| 1990s | 61.3% | 94.3% | 33.0% | Rwanda |
| 2000s | 68.4% | 76.8% | 8.4% | Rwanda |
| 2010s | 68.8% | 62.5% | 6.3% | Bolivia, Plurinational State of |
| 2020s | 73.4% | 53.5% | 19.9% | Bolivia, Plurinational State of |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
